23 * SUMMARY: Passing (RegExp object, flag) to RegExp() function.
24 * This test arose from Bugzilla bug 61266. The ECMA3 section is:
26 * 15.10.3 The RegExp Constructor Called as a Function
28 * 15.10.3.1 RegExp(pattern, flags)
30 * If pattern is an object R whose [[Class]] property is "RegExp"
31 * and flags is undefined, then return R unchanged. Otherwise
32 * call the RegExp constructor (section 15.10.4.1), passing it the
33 * pattern and flags arguments and return the object constructed
34 * by that constructor.
37 * The current test will check the first scenario outlined above:
39 * "pattern" is itself a RegExp object R
40 * "flags" is undefined
42 * This test is identical to test 15.10.3.1-1.js, except here we do:
44 * RegExp(R, undefined);
51 * We check that RegExp(R, undefined) returns R -
